Ke’Aniya Tyasian Thomas was born September 30, 2008, in Columbia, South Carolina, to Kimberly Maxine Eady–Capers and Tyrone Thomas.
At an early age, she sought God's direction and worshipped at Greater Faith Temple C.O.G.I.C. in Fairfax, SC, under the leadership of Elder Paul Johnson.
Ke‘Aniya was a native of Columbia, SC, and she later moved to Aiken County with her family. She attended Kennedy Middle School and she became a proud cadet of the JROTC Program. In 2023, she graduated from Kennedy Middle School.
Ke‘Aniya was a sophomore at Aiken High School who excelled in her studies. She was currently enrolled in the culinary arts program.
“Niya,” as she was affectionately called, was a very spiritual teenager who believed in the “power of prayer.” She expressed daily, “Don’t forget to pray!” She enjoyed traveling, shopping, and cooking with her family, alongside expressing her desire to become a chef. “Niya” was a devoted daughter, sister, and loyal to her special friend, and she will forever be remembered for the love she had for her family.
Our loved one has been taken, but God has gained another angel. On Sunday, April 6, 2025, Ke‘Aniya was called home to be with the Lord in the comfort of her home.
